Topic :" Emerging Trends and the Transformation potential of Technology in the Construction Industry";
A great topic because the Construction Industry/Engineering represent 13% of GDP. However, Construction Industry has only grown 1% in productivity, over the past decade.
Technology Trends:
1-Technology enablers-Big Data, Digital Twins, IOT, Mobile and Cloud Computing,
2-Digital Solutions-AI/ML, BIM, Blockchain, Robotic Process, GIS, RFID, Low-Code/No-Code platform
3-On Site Execution-Robotics, Augmented Reality, Drones, #d Printing, Wearables Saving Changes...

Construction projects are very complex in terms of stakeholders when you consider the Owner which can be made up of users and deliverers of the project including procurement departments, project management departments, subject matter experts, security personnel, senior management overview, etc. Then you have the design consultants (architects, engineers), construction managers, general contractors, trade contractors, suppliers, material handlers, etc. Each of these have project management teams including cost and time managers, quality control, risk managers, senior management overviews as well as the front line workers. The application and integration of modern Information Technology (IT) is a challenge. Ultimately the labourer on the wheelbarrow is as critical as the Vice President of operations. He/she has to be at the right place, at the right time with the right quantity of the right material. Saving Changes...
